Heleno dos Santos
Heleno dos Santos Alves is a professional football player from Brazil who plays as a midfielder. Heleno began his youth career at Sao Vicente, in 1998-99, but his senior debut would come , in 2000, with Rio Branco. After a single season with the club, Heleno moved on to play for America Futebol Clube in 2002-03 and then, in 2004-05, signed with Vila Nova Futebol Clube.
While playing for Vila Nova, Heleno became a part of the 2005 Campeonato Goiano title winning team. He moved onto Santos, in 2005-06, and won the league title with a fantastic Santos side. That said, Heleno was hardly a regular member of the starting line-up playing in teams that had too many quality players ahead of him.
His big break would come when signed with Sport Club do Recife in 2007. Heleno played 26 games that season, starting most of them, and was extremely influential in his performance. In 2007-08, Vila Nova became his club as Heleno moved back to the team where he won the title. In 2009, he moved to Ceara Sporting Clube where he continues his struggles to play regularly at the highest level of Brazilian football.
